+/*
+ *----------------------------------------------------------------------
+ *
+ * TclMacOSXMatchType --
+ *
+ * This routine is used by the globbing code to check if a file matches a
+ * given mac type and/or creator code.
+ *
+ * Results:
+ * The return value is 1, 0 or -1 indicating whether the file matches the
+ * given criteria, does not match them, or an error occurred (in wich
+ * case an error is left in interp).
+ *
+ * Side effects:
+ * None.
+ *
+ *----------------------------------------------------------------------
+ */
+
+int
+TclMacOSXMatchType(
+ Tcl_Interp *interp, /* Interpreter to receive errors. */
+ const char *pathName, /* Native path to check. */
+ const char *fileName, /* Native filename to check. */
+ Tcl_StatBuf *statBufPtr, /* Stat info for file to check */
+ Tcl_GlobTypeData *types) /* Type description to match against. */
+{
+#ifdef HAVE_GETATTRLIST
+ struct attrlist alist;
+ fileinfobuf finfo;
+ finderinfo *finder = (finderinfo *) &finfo.data;
+ OSType osType;
- Tcl_DStringFree(&ds_src);
- Tcl_DStringFree(&ds_dst);
+ bzero(&alist, sizeof(struct attrlist));
+ alist.bitmapcount = ATTR_BIT_MAP_COUNT;
+ alist.commonattr = ATTR_CMN_FNDRINFO;
+ if (getattrlist(pathName, &alist, &finfo, sizeof(fileinfobuf), 0) != 0) {
+ return 0;
+ }
+ if ((types->perm & TCL_GLOB_PERM_HIDDEN) &&
+ !((finder->fdFlags & kFinfoIsInvisible) || (*fileName == '.'))) {
+ return 0;
+ }
+ if (S_ISDIR(statBufPtr->st_mode)
+ && (types->macType || types->macCreator)) {
+ /*
+ * Directories don't support types or creators.
+ */
- if (result != 0) {
- return TCL_ERROR;
- }
+ return 0;
+ }
+ if (types->macType) {
+ if (GetOSTypeFromObj(interp, types->macType, &osType) != TCL_OK) {
+ return -1;
+ }
+ if (osType != OSSwapBigToHostInt32(finder->type)) {
+ return 0;
+ }
+ }
+ if (types->macCreator) {
+ if (GetOSTypeFromObj(interp, types->macCreator, &osType) != TCL_OK) {
+ return -1;
+ }
+ if (osType != OSSwapBigToHostInt32(finder->creator)) {
+ return 0;
}
}
- return TCL_OK;
-#else
- return TCL_ERROR;
#endif
+ return 1;
}
